Contracts Analyst

Location: Dallas, Texas

This position will be responsible for performing a range of commercial and contractual activities appropriate to the individual’s knowledge, abilities and experience. This may range from the provision of! general commercial advice and responses to customer queries, the provision of commercial support to product lines, the preparation and negotiation of a variety of contractual and bid documents of some complexity for more experienced role holders. The role may also include the provision of first-line legal and regulatory advice, in particular the commercial implications of such advice. The role will support the Contracts Solutions Group (“CS Group”) of UnitedLex, including assisting a team of contracts professionals who support the contracts and procurement services provided by the CS Group to the legal and procurement departments of F500 companies, including clients in the telecommunications sector. This position will report directly to the Contracts Manager in the CS Group and will assist with providing high quality contracts services and well-crafted contracts solutions to UnitedLex’s new and existing telecommunications clients.

Responsibilities: Provide professional and independent commercial and contract! ual management services to support the client’s customer-facing trading activities, including:

Commercial Support - Providing commercial advice and direction to business units, and working with them to negotiate and deliver profitable and commercially-effective contracts with customers and distributors. The role holder may assist a more senior team member on complex commercial arrangements under suitable guidance, support and supervision.

Developing commercial propositions for new and revised products and services including business case input and the review and drafting of contract terms.

Corporate Governance - Providing an independent view of trading activities, to ensure that client’s goals are achieved. Briefing and recommending to line management whether non-standard business should be authorized.

Policy Setting - Ensuring consistency of application of trading policy across the line of business, and where possible the standardiza! tion of terms and conditions across client’s business units.

Process Development- assist the Contract Manager with the development of processes that will be used to standardize contracting for both the US team and the India team.

Risk - Ensuring production and implementation of commercial risk analyses for bids, tenders, contracts and product business cases.

Prepare, analyze and review high volume and diverse range of agreements, contracts, schedules and exhibits, correspondence, certifications and other legal documents including but not limited to Request for Proposal responses, Statements of Work, Non-Disclosure Agreements, and Amendments.

Assist with the maintenance and improvement of legal forms, documents, contract databases, etc.; catalog, track and maintain documents and information for reporting and data management purposes and for tracking contractual obligations.

Resolve routine issues such as amendments and renewals ! and consult with attorneys when complex legal questions arise that requ! ire attorney input.

Administer processes to: (i) ensure consistent use of best practice terms and conditions; (ii) ensure proposed changes receive appropriate review and approval; (iii) encourage use of standard legal forms; (iv) standardize approval, execution and archiving processes; and (v) track and report all key deadlines.

Utilize SharePoint and other software applications.

Assist with maintenance of the department’s contracts management software including the population of contract details and the scanning and uploading of relevant contract information.

Review of contracts for deviations to standard language.

Data and process integrity in contracts database.

Required Experience:
BA/BS degree (preferably in finance, accounting, business, economics or other analytical business degrees) from reputable university, including top academic credentials (based on transcript).

Prior telecommunic! ations experience is preferred.

Knowledge of Vendor and Supplier Agreements preferred.

At least 3 years of prior commercial contracts experience is required.

Ability to work independently.

Reasonable commercial, legal, regulatory and business acumen.

Awareness and understanding of need to escalate issues to line management.

High attention to details; excellent verbal and written communication skills, including drafting.

IACCM, NCMA certifications, paralegal certificate or similar certifications a plus.

Experience with contracts management software and other document management systems a plus.

Ability to manage multiple projects and conflicting priorities while maintaining high attention to quality and detail.

Demonstrated ability to think “outside the box” by making recommendations for improvements to processes and tools.

Strong MS Office (Excel, WORD, PowerPoint, Outlook,! and Access) skills.

Effective time management skills and high! ly motivated to succeed.
